When attaching to a leaf or spine from my APIC, I end up getting the prompt:
admin@leaf1:~>
shouldnt I (or how do I) get the logon:
admin@leaf1#
My command options are severely limited without the # prompt. This is in dCloud and ACI Sim. Is it that this is simulated hardware vs actual hardware?

This is in dCloud and ACI Sim. Is it that this is simulated hardware vs actual hardware?
Precisely. You've answered your own question. The simulator only simulates the GUI and the API, not the CLI. What you are seeing is expected behaviour for the SIM, and don't expect many commands to work at all at the bash prompt.
There is one dcloud lab that uses real hardware; https://dcloud-cms.cisco.com/demo_news/cisco-application-centric-infrastructure-with-shared-physical-fabric-v1 but you don't get admin rights to that one, and AFAIK you won't get access to the CLI, but it might be worth a try.
